A repository for implementing and testing an autonomous agentic pipeline on a real robotic environment using an N9 robotic station (https://www.northrobotics.com/robots).
- Clone the repository:
git clone https://github.com/katerinavr/SDL-Agents.git
cd SDL-Agents
- Install dependencies:
pip install -r requirements.txt
- Add the API keys (config/settings.py):
OPENAI_API_KEY = ""
anthropic_api_key = ""
- Run the Gradio app:
python app.py
